The Clark County Board of Commissioners approved the meeting agenda, unanimously authorized a quitclaim reconveyance to Raymond Reil, and adjourned; motions were moved and seconded as recorded in the official minutes.

The Clark County Board of Commissioners began its August 27, 2024 special session with a procedural vote to approve the meeting agenda. Commissioner Sara Gjerde moved and Commissioner Francis Hass seconded the motion "to approve agenda of August 27, 2024; All voting aye. Motion carried."

Later in the session, Commissioner Wallace Knock moved and Commissioner Francis Hass seconded a motion to reconvey described parcels in Hayward's Addition to Raymond Reil and to authorize the chairman to sign a quitclaim deed; the board recorded a unanimous 'All voting aye' vote on that motion as well. The meeting closed on a motion by Commissioner Terry Schlagel, seconded by Commissioner Wallace Knock to adjourn at 1:06 p.m. until the regular meeting on September 3, 2024; the motion carried with all voting aye.

These procedural entries are recorded in the official minutes; the transcript does not indicate public comment or extended debate on these motion items. The clerk/auditor attested to the minutes, and the meeting record is signed by Christine Tarbox, Clark County Auditor, and Chris Sass, Chairman.
